James Leon Stanfield (born 1934) is a former Welsh international lawn bowler.

Bowls career[edit]

Stanfield became the British singles champion after winning the British Isles Bowls Championships in 1966.[1][2] He was a teacher by trade and was the Secretary for the Troedyrhiw Bowls Club.[3]
